xyOps
xyOps is a next-generation workflow automation system designed to help teams orchestrate and manage their entire infrastructure from a single, unified platform. It combines powerful capabilities such as job scheduling, real-time monitoring, alerting, and integrated ticketing into one cohesive solution, eliminating the need to rely on multiple disconnected tools. Built with scalability and flexibility in mind, xyOps allows organizations to streamline operations, automate repetitive processes, and maintain full visibility over their systems regardless of size or complexity. At its core, xyOps reimagines traditional job scheduling by going far beyond the limitations of standard cron-based systems. Users can create advanced workflows using a visual editor that connects events, triggers, actions, and monitoring conditions into structured pipelines. xyOps improves workflow automation by allowing users to create complex workflows with conditional logic, parallel execution, and custom queues using a visual editor. This graphical approach simplifies the design of automation processes and enhances control over operations.
xyOps provides robust monitoring capabilities that allow users to track metrics such as CPU usage, memory consumption, network activity, and disk performance in real time. Users can also define custom metrics tailored to specific workloads and access historical performance data through detailed graphs.
The alerting system in xyOps is intelligent and flexible, allowing users to configure alerts based on specific expressions and rules. Notifications can be sent via email, webhooks, or custom channels, and alerts can trigger automated actions, such as launching jobs or creating tickets, for faster incident response.
Yes, xyOps is designed to work across environments of any scale, managing anything from a handful of servers to thousands of nodes in a distributed cluster. It supports redundancy through hot backups to ensure uninterrupted operations.
xyOps supports deployment on macOS, Linux, and Windows systems, making it a versatile solution for diverse infrastructures.
xyOps can be integrated with other tools through its fully scriptable API, allowing for seamless integration with CI/CD pipelines and other development tools. Additionally, it features a plugin-based architecture that enables users to create custom functionality.
